Summary:Drawing on the historical context, empirical studies, case examples, and experiential data, this book brings together the voices of women from a range of cultures--Japanese, Korean, Vietnamese, Chinese, Indian, and Pacific Islander--who address the issues of cultural and gender role identity and stereotypes as they influence and are influenced by the relationships with family, community, and the law.
